Bullets are fires at regulart intervals of 10sec. from an armoured car A moving with a speed of `36km//` hour . At what interval with an officer seated in a car B hear the report when the car B is stationary and car A is moving towards car B. Velocity of sound `=330` metre `//` sec. and velocity of wind `=10` metres `//` sec in the direction AB.
